What You’ll Do: As Workday Analyst, you will be responsible for liaising and maintaining the core global ERP platform in support of Northland Power’s business objectives. In this role, you will primarily provide technical expertise as it pertains to Workday ERP – Human Capital Management (HCM), Performance, Talent, Workforce, and Payroll and other Workday services; provide business analysis in assessing and designing enterprise application solutions and ensuring standards and best practices are followed. You will collaborate closely with the Workday team, internal business partners, and designated vendors and partners, addressing business demand and support inquiries and ensuring that global business applications in scope are operational within the agreed service level agreements. Key Accountabilities: Manage and support the Workday ERP system, primarily HCM functions, Benefits, Advance Compensation, Absence, Time Tracking, Recruiting, Talent, Performance, Succession and Payroll. Provide support for other Workday functions, including finance, strategic sourcing and more. Collaborate with business functional owners, superusers and vendors to align application solutions with organizational objectives. Plan, design, develop and deploy Workday solutions, create reports, dashboards, KPIs, discovery boards, workbooks, and manage vendor releases, patches, and enhancements. Lead business requirements gathering and prepare business requirements documents. Provide technical leadership in IT/OT application projects and implementations, working with implementation teams and vendors. Maintain IT standards throughout the SDLC and assist with ongoing systems and process improvement initiatives. Support the Manager, Enterprise Applications in ensuring vendors and service providers deliver quality solutions based on SLAs. Develop and maintain documentation relating to the technical environment, including testing and support. Qualifications and Experience: Bachelor’s degree in computer science or an equivalent business or related field. 3+ years of experience implementing and supporting Workday with a focus on configuring HR & Payroll modules; Workday HR/Payroll certifications are a must. Proficiency in the Finance module and strategic sourcing module, and an understanding of system integrations is an asset. 3+ years of experience eliciting business requirements and preparing business requirement documents. Minimum 5+ years of experience supporting business application systems, solution development, technical design system integrations, configuration and deployment along with end‑user requirements and support. Strong understanding of human resources principles and HR & Payroll processes. Proficiency in implementing most Workday HCM related modules. Extensive knowledge in Workday report writing, dashboards, worklets, and KPIs. Proficiency with Microsoft enterprise products, development tools, and methodologies. Experience with Waterfall/Agile/Scrum methodologies and traditional SDLC methodologies. Knowledge of ITIL framework. Understanding of SaaS solution implementation approaches and cloud development tools. Excellent verbal and written communication skills with all levels of users and management. Strong influencing, negotiation and conflict resolution skills. Self‑motivated team player with strong planning and quality decision‑making skills and strong presentation skills.
